Summary
This 8-K filing by Realty Income Corporation (O) primarily serves to update investors on changes related to United States Federal Income Tax Considerations. The company is superseding previous discussions on this topic from its August 4, 2016 Form 8-K filing and its December 21, 2015 prospectus. This indicates a proactive approach by Realty Income to ensure its disclosures align with any recent changes in tax law that may impact the company or its shareholders. Investors should pay close attention to the updated "United States Federal Income Tax Considerations" section in Exhibit 99.1. This exhibit is crucial as it replaces all prior discussions on the subject, suggesting significant modifications or clarifications are being made. While the filing itself does not detail the specific tax changes, it directs stakeholders to the revised disclosure for comprehensive information, which is essential for understanding potential tax implications of owning Realty Income shares.
